Skin Sensitivity Compatibility

Choosing the right scalp toner for sensitive skin can be simple. Look for products labeled hypoallergenic. Make sure the toner is made for sensitive skin to lower irritation risk. Choose soothing ingredients such as aloe vera, chamomile, or oat extract. These ingredients calm the scalp. Use products that are fragrance-free and dye-free. Artificial scents and colors can cause irritation. Check the pH level. Keep it between 4.5 and 5.5. This helps maintain your skin’s natural barrier. Avoid alcohol, parabens, and harsh chemicals. These ingredients can trigger sensitivities. Selecting a gentle toner benefits your scalp health.

Key Ingredient Efficacy

For your scalp toner to reduce itch and soothe irritation, choose ingredients that work effectively. Hypochlorous acid (HOCl) is a powerful ingredient. It kills bacteria and reduces inflammation quickly. Think of it as a small, invisible soldier fighting for your scalp. Witch hazel is another helpful ingredient. It tightens blood vessels and eases redness, providing a calming effect. Rose water gently calms redness and irritation, leaving your scalp feeling fresh. Glycerin is a strong humectant. It pulls moisture into dry spots, easing dryness and itchiness. These ingredients are proven to help reduce irritation and support healthy skin. When picking a toner, look for these ingredients to get real relief and comfort.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can Scalp Toners Help With Dandruff or Scalp Psoriasis?

Yes, scalp toners can help with dandruff and psoriasis by soothing irritation, reducing dryness, and balancing scalp pH. However, for severe cases, consult a dermatologist for targeted treatments alongside gentle toners.

Are Natural Ingredients More Effective Than Synthetic Ones?

Natural ingredients often work better for gentle scalp soothing because they are less likely to cause irritation. You’ll find they help reduce itchiness and inflammation more effectively, while synthetic ingredients may sometimes trigger sensitivities and side effects.

How Often Should I Apply a Scalp-Soothing Toner?

You should apply a scalp-soothing toner twice daily, morning and evening. If your scalp feels especially itchy or irritated, consider increasing to three times, but avoid overuse to prevent dryness or irritation.

Can Toners Be Used Alongside Medicated Scalp Treatments?

Yes, you can use toners with medicated scalp treatments, but it’s best to wait a few minutes between applications. Always follow your dermatologist’s instructions, and avoid mixing products to prevent irritation and guarantee effectiveness.

Are Alcohol-Based Toners Safe for Sensitive Scalps?

Alcohol-based toners can irritate sensitive scalps, so it’s best to avoid them if your skin is easily irritated. Instead, opt for alcohol-free options that soothe and refresh without causing discomfort or dryness.
